Review Analysis
Kora Moving has 314 online customer reviews, with 93% of them being positive. Customers frequently praise the company's efficiency and professionalism, noting how quickly their moves were completed without damage to belongings. Many highlighted the friendly and hardworking staff who made moving easier. On the downside, some feedback pointed to issues with late arrivals and unexpected charges, which detracted from an otherwise excellent service. Despite these concerns, Kora Moving is recognized as a reliable choice in the Bay Area, often outperforming competitors in both price and quality of service.

Is Kora Moving properly licensed?toggle

When contacting a local moving company for an estimate in California, make sure each has a โ€œT Numberโ€ issued by the California Public Utilities Commission (CAPUC).

Moving companies with valid T Numbers have met state requirements for insurance, safety, and financial stability and have passed criminal clearance checks conducted by the California Department of Justice.

The state license number for Kora Moving is: 0192173 , USDOT #: 3139436.

You can also use their state regulator website to look up their active status.

Should you negotiate with San Francisco movers?toggle

While haggling over moving costs isn't typically effective, there are still ways to save. Many companies offer ongoing moving discounts for groups like seniors, military personnel, and students, as well as special offers for early-bird reservations.

Getting quotes from multiple companies will also allow you to inquire about price matching. Some movers will honor lower quotes from competitors, so it doesnโ€™t hurt to ask โ€” and be ready to show estimates from other companies.
